Summary
↔ is an Unicode character[1].
Key Facts
- ↔'s image is recorded as U+2194.svg[2].
- ↔'s instance of is recorded as Unicode character[3].
- ↔'s instance of is recorded as emoji[4].
- ↔'s depicts is recorded as logical equivalence[5].
- ↔'s depicts is recorded as if and only if[6].
- ↔'s Commons category is recorded as U+2194[7].
- ↔'s Unicode character is recorded as ↔[8].
- ↔'s Unicode code point is recorded as 2194[9].
- ↔'s HTML entity is recorded as ↔[10].
- ↔'s HTML entity is recorded as ↔[11].
- ↔'s HTML entity is recorded as ↔[12].
- ↔'s HTML entity is recorded as ↔[13].
- ↔'s HTML entity is recorded as ↔[14].
- ↔'s 3D model is recorded as U+2194 Noto Sans Math 20230108.stl[15].
- ↔'s GlyphWiki ID is recorded as u2194[16].
- ↔'s Unicode block is recorded as Arrows[17].
- ↔'s Emojipedia ID is recorded as left-right-arrow[18].
- ↔'s Unicode character name is recorded as LEFT RIGHT ARROW[19].
- ↔'s shortcode is recorded as :left_right_arrow:[20].
